!!! Tip "Note"

Embeddings table for a given dataset and model pair is only created once and reused. These use [LanceDB](https://lancedb.github.io/lancedb/) under the hood, which scales on-disk, so you can create and reuse embeddings for large datasets like COCO without running out of memory.

In case you want to force update the embeddings table, you can pass `force=True` to `create_embeddings_table` method.
You can direclty access the LanceDB table object to perform advanced analysis. Learn more about it in [Working with table section](#4-advanced---working-with-embeddings-table)

## 1. Similarity Search

Similarity search is a technique for finding similar images to a given image. It is based on the idea that similar images will have similar embeddings. Once the embeddings table is built, you can get run semantic search in any of the following ways:

When using large datasets, you can also create a dedicated vector index for faster querying. This is done using the `create_index` method on LanceDB table.

```python
table.create_index(num_partitions=..., num_sub_vectors=...)
table.create_index(num_partitions=..., num_sub_vectors=...)
```

Find more details on the type vector indices available and parameters [here](https://lancedb.github.io/lancedb/ann_indexes/#types-of-index) In the future, we will add support for creating vector indices directly from Explorer API.

## Ask AI

This allows you to write how you want to filter your dataset using natural language. You don't have to be proficient in writing SQL queries. Our AI powered query generator will automatically do that under the hood. For example - you can say - "show me 100 images with exactly one person and 2 dogs. There can be other objects too" and it'll internally generate the query and show you those results. Here's an example output when asked to "Show 10 images with exactly 5 persons" and you'll see a result like this:

!!! tip

Explorer works on embedding/semantic search & SQL querying and is powered by [LanceDB](https://lancedb.com/) serverless vector database. Unlike traditional in-memory DBs, it is persisted on disk without sacrificing performance, so you can scale locally to large datasets like COCO without running out of memory.

!!! note "Note"
Ask AI feature works using OpenAI, so you'll be prompted to set the api key for OpenAI when you first run the GUI.
You can set it like this - `yolo settings openai_api_key="..."`
